Safety Signal Words
The safety signal words Danger, Warning, Caution, and Notice have the following meanings:
DANGER | DANGER indicates a hazardous situation which, if not avoided, will result in death or serious injury. |
WARNING | WARNING indicates a hazardous situation which, if not avoided, could result in death or serious injury. |
CAUTION | CAUTION, used with the safety alert symbol, indicates a hazardous situation which, if not avoided, could result in minor or moderate injury. |
NOTICE | NOTICE is used to address practices not related to personal injury. |
Warranty
Product warranty will expire 12+1 months after dispatch from Atlas Copco's Distribution Center.
Normal wear and tear on parts is not included within the warranty.
Normal wear and tear is that which requires a part change or other adjustment/overhaul during standard tools maintenance typical for that period (expressed in time, operation hours or otherwise).
The product warranty relies on the correct use, maintenance, and repair of the tool and its component parts.
Damage to parts that occurs as a result of inadequate maintenance or performed by parties other than Atlas Copco or their Certified Service Partners during the warranty period is not covered by the warranty.
To avoid damage or destruction of tool parts, service the tool according to the recommended maintenance schedules and follow the correct instructions.
Warranty repairs are only performed in Atlas Copco workshops or by Certified Service Partners.

Connecting a Water Separator
The length of the air hose between the compressor and the water separator must be such that the water vapor is cooled and condensed in the hose before reaching the water separator.
If the ambient temperature is below 0°C (32°F) the hose must be short enough to prevent the water from freezing before reaching the water separator.
Air Quality
Good lubrication is important for the function and maintenance of the tool.
If there is no integrated lubricator, connect a separate lubricator to the air hose.
The length of the air hose between the tool and the separate lubricator should not be longer than 3 meters.
Use a synthetic lubricant such as Atlas Copco Breaker and hammer AIR-OIL or a mineral oil with the properties recommended in the table.
Lubricant | Temperature range | Viscosity |
---|---|---|
Breaker and hammer AIR-OIL | -30 to +50 | - |
Mineral oil/Synthetic oil | +15 to +50 | ISO VG 46-68 |
Mineral oil/Synthetic oil | -20 to +15 | ISO VG 22-32 |
Preventing Freezing in Silencer
The tool is designed to prevent ice formation in the silencer. But under extreme conditions ice can be formed in the silencer.
Ice formation in the silencer can occur when the ambient air temperature is 0-10°C (32-50°F) and the relative humidity is high.
To prevent ice formation in the silencer, do the following:
Use the Atlas Copco Breaker and hammer AIR-OIL as a lubricant. Breaker and hammer AIR-OIL counteracts freezing.
Use a water separator.
Air Quality
For optimum performance and maximum product life we recommend the use of compressed air with a maximum dew point of +10°C (50°F). We also recommend to install an Atlas Copco refrigeration type air dryer.
Use a separate air filter which removes solid particles larger than 30 microns and more than 90% of liquid water. Install the filter as close as possible to the product and prior to any other air preparation units to avoid pressure drop.
For impulse/impact tools make sure to use lubricators adjusted for these tools. Regular lubricators will add too much oil and therefore decrease the tool performance due to too much oil in the motor.
Make sure that the hose and couplings are clean and free from dust before connecting to the tool.
Both lubricated and lubrication free products will benefit from a small quantity of oil supplied from a lubricator.

Make sure that the air pressure is correct, 6 bar (87 psi).
Choose the correct dimension and length for the compressed air hose:
For hose lengths up to 30 m (100 ft) use a hose with a minimum internal diameter of 19 mm (3/4 in).
For hose length is between 30 and 100 m (100 and 330 ft) use a hose with a minimum internal diameter of 25 mm (1 in).

Ergonomic Guidelines
Consider your workstation as you read through this list of general ergonomic guidelines to identify areas for improvement in posture, component placement, or work environment.
Take frequent breaks and change work positions frequently.
Adapt the workstation area to your needs and the work task.
Adjust for a convenient reach range by determining where parts and tools need to be located to avoid static load.
Use workstation equipment such as tables and chairs appropriate for the work task.
Avoid work positions above shoulder level or with static holding during assembly operations.
When working above shoulder level, reduce the load on the static muscles by lowering the weight of the tool, using for example torque arms, hose reels or weight balancers. You can also reduce the load on the static muscles by holding the tool close to the body.
Take frequent breaks.
Avoid extreme arm or wrist postures, particularly during operations requiring a degree of force.
Adjust for a convenient field of vision that requires minimal eye and head movements.
Use appropriate lighting for the work task.
Select the appropriate tool for the work task.
In noisy environments, use ear protection equipment.
Use high-quality inserted tools and consumables to minimize exposure to excessive levels of vibration.
Minimize exposure to reaction forces.
When cutting:
A cut-off wheel can get stuck if the cut-off wheel is bent or not guided properly. Use the correct flange for the cut-off wheel and avoid bending the cut-off wheel during operation.
When drilling:
The drill might stall when the drill bit breaks through. Use support handles if the stall torque is high. The safety standard ISO11148 part 3 recommends using a device to absorb a reaction torque above 10 Nm for pistol grip tools and 4 Nm for straight tools.
When using direct-driven screwdrivers or nutrunners:
Reaction forces depend on the tool settings and joint characteristics. Strength and posture determine the amount of reaction force that an operator can tolerate. Adapt the torque setting to the operator's strength and posture and use a torque arm or reaction bar if the torque is too high.
In dusty environments, use a dust extraction system or wear a mouth protection mask.

Choosing the Correct Pneumatic Hammer
Make sure to choose the correct size of pneumatic hammer for the work to be done. A too small hammer will make the work take longer. A too big hammer requires frequent repositioning and is tiring for the operator.
It should take about 5-10 seconds to remove a normal sized piece of broken material from a workpiece. If it takes less than 5 seconds, choose a smaller pneumatic hammer. If it takes more than 10 seconds, choose a larger pneumatic hammer.
